Output bb8821fbcac86dcf3a01f05c4edb968969ad3d2ca46dd27eab095991b7b7233e:22

value
625265
script pubkey
OP_0 OP_PUSHBYTES_20 42e207aecbb65465368dbec164043e5a69811f71
address
bc1qgt3q0tktke2x2d5dhmqkgpp7tf5cz8m38jg9rz
transaction
bb8821fbcac86dcf3a01f05c4edb968969ad3d2ca46dd27eab095991b7b7233e
confirmations
6804
spent
true